Transaction 720768b4a5c52892afb20411dc391749d5835d4866293d32dfa35e9203d89485
1 Input
1 Output
-
720768b4a5c52892afb20411dc391749d5835d4866293d32dfa35e9203d89485:0
- value
- 150898963
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6801bd669019bb3045a3b53e725d6e4da737b146 OP_EQUAL
- address
- 3BAxHP37AxUXoMNu4gRGBofbcLi33dz8L1